0-10V DALI Converter: A Comprehensive Guide

Introduction

In the world of lighting control, two prominent protocols have emerged: 0-10V and DALI (Digital Addressable Lighting Interface). While both protocols have their strengths, they are not directly compatible. This is where the 0-10V DALI converter comes in, allowing for seamless integration between these two systems.

What is 0-10V?

0-10V is a analog lighting control protocol that uses a variable voltage signal to control the brightness of lighting fixtures. The voltage signal ranges from 0 to 10 volts, with 0V representing the minimum brightness and 10V representing the maximum brightness. This protocol is widely used in traditional lighting control systems.

What is DALI?

DALI is a digital lighting control protocol that uses a two-way communication system to control lighting fixtures. It is a more advanced protocol that offers features like individual fixture addressing, automatic configuration, and real-time monitoring. DALI is widely used in modern lighting control systems, especially in commercial and industrial applications.

The Need for 0-10V DALI Converter

While DALI offers more advanced features than 0-10V, many legacy lighting systems still use 0-10V. Integrating DALI devices into these systems requires a converter that can translate the 0-10V analog signal into a DALI digital signal. This is where the 0-10V DALI converter comes in.

How Does the 0-10V DALI Converter Work?

The 0-10V DALI converter is a device that converts the 0-10V analog signal into a DALI digital signal. It consists of a microcontroller that reads the 0-10V signal and generates a corresponding DALI signal. The converter can be connected to a DALI controller, which then controls the connected lighting fixtures.
